Tavernale (Bridge Tavern), 7 Akenside Hill, Newcastle upon Tyne, Tyne & Wear NE1 3UF

The pub, formerly the Newcastle Arms, was rebuilt in 1925 when it need to be repositioned due to the construction of the Tyne Bridge.

Brewing commenced in September 2013 in association with the Wylam Brewery Ltd.
